๐Ÿ“š What Does It Mean to Help Others in Class?

Helping others in class means doing things to make your classmates' learning experience easier and more enjoyable. It's about being kind, considerate, and supportive. These actions can create a positive and collaborative environment where everyone feels comfortable and can succeed.

๐ŸŒŸ Key Principles of Being a Helpful Classmate

  • ๐Ÿค Empathy: Try to understand how your classmates are feeling. If they seem frustrated, offer encouragement.
  • ๐Ÿ‘‚ Active Listening: Pay attention when your classmates are speaking and try to understand their ideas.
  • ๐ŸŒฑ Patience: Some things take time to learn. Be patient with your classmates as they work through challenges.
  • ๐Ÿ’– Kindness: Use kind words and actions in all your interactions.
  • ๐ŸŒ Inclusivity: Make sure everyone feels included in activities and discussions.

๐ŸŒฑ Practical Steps for Helping Classmates (Grade 1 Actions)

  • โœ๏ธ Share Supplies: Offer a classmate a pencil or crayon if they don't have one.
  • โ“ Answer Questions: If a classmate has a question and the teacher is busy, try to help them if you know the answer.
  • ๐Ÿง‘โ€๐Ÿคโ€๐Ÿง‘ Offer Encouragement: Say things like "You can do it!" or "That's a great idea!"
  • ๐Ÿง‘โ€๐Ÿซ Help with Instructions: If a classmate is confused about what to do, gently explain the directions again.
  • ๐Ÿ“– Read Together: Offer to read with a classmate who is struggling with a reading assignment.
  • ๐ŸŽจ Help with Projects: Offer to help with cutting, gluing, or coloring on group projects.
  • ๐Ÿงฉ Work Together: Help other classmates do puzzles or other activities in free time.

๐ŸŽญ Real-World Examples

  • ๐ŸŽ Sharing Snacks: Imagine a classmate forgot their snack. You could offer to share some of yours!
  • ๐Ÿงฎ Math Help: If a classmate is struggling with a math problem, you could show them how you solved it.
  • ๐Ÿ—ฃ๏ธ Speaking Up: If you see someone being left out, you could invite them to join your game or group.
